Sigma 120-400mm F4.5/5.6 DG OS HSM

SPECIFICATIONS:
- Optical Stabiliser
This telephoto zoom lens incorporates Sigmas original OS (Optical Stabiliser)
system. It offers the equivalent of using a shutter speed approximately 4
stops faster.
- Incorporated with SLD Glass
Three SLD (Special Low Dispersion) glass elements provide excellent correction
for chromatic aberration. This lens is equipped with the rear focus system
that minimises fluctuation of aberrations caused by focusing. It provides
optimum image quality throughout the entire zoom range. The super multi-layer
lens coating reduces flare and ghosting. High image quality is assured throughout
the entire zoom range.
- Minimum focusing distance of 150cm
The minimum focusing distance of 150cm throughout the entire zoom range and
has a maximum magnification of 1:4.2 make it useful for close-up photography.
- HSM
This lens incorporates HSM (Hyper Sonic Motor), which ensures a quiet and
high-speed AF as well as full-time manual focus override.
- Compatible with Sigma APO Tele
Converters
The addition of the optical 1.4x EX DG APO or 2x EX DG APO Tele Converters
produce a 168-560mm F6.3-8 MF ultra-telephoto zoom lens or a 240-800mm F9-11
MF ultra-telephoto zoom lens respectively.
(See the Compatibility Table for information.)
- Detachable tripod collar
A removable tripod collar and matched lens hood is included as a standard
component.
- Lens Construction 21 Elements
in 15 Groups
- Angle of View 20.4 - 6.2 degrees
- Number of Diaphragm Blades 9 Blades
- Minimum Aperture F32
- Minimum Focusing Distance 150cm
- Maximum Magnification 1:4.2
- Filter Size 77mm
- Dimensions Diameter 92mm X Length
203mm
- Weight 1640g
